The required take-up length is calculated as follows, where . S Sp = take-up length (m) L = conveyor length (m) ε = belt elongation, elastic and permanent (%) As a rough guideline, use 1,5 % elongation for textile belts. and 0,2 % for steel cord belts. History. The mechanical belt drive, using a pulley machine, was first mentioned in the text the Dictionary of Local Expressions by the Han Dynasty philosopher, poet, and politician Yang Xiong (53–18 BC) in 15 BC, used for a quilling machine that wound silk fibers on to bobbins for weavers' shuttles. The belt drive is an essential component of the invention of the spinning wheel.

Slip is caused by overloads and in this case, the belt slides over the entire arc of contact on the pulley. The power losses in the belt drive are made up of the following factors: (i) Power loss due to belt creep on the pulley. A Drive Pulley or Head Pulley is used for the purpose of driving a conveyor belt. They are normally mounted in external type bearings and driven by a motor and reducer. Conveyor head pulleys can be flat faced or crowned and many have lagging to reduce belt slippage. Conveyor drum pulleys, wing pulleys and spiral pulleys are the most common

04.08.2020There is a different belt length formula common among engineers. It's an approximation of the one given above: Belt length = ((D L + D S) * π / 2) + (2 * L) + (D L - D S) 2 / (4 * L). where: D L is the diameter of the large pulley;; D S is the diameter of the smaller pulley; and; L is the distance between the pulley axles.; You can find the belt length calculated with

09.05.2021Also, you can calculate belt width as, 4.Capacity of conveyor (Q ) Tonnes/hr. The rate at which material is being carried out by the conveyor. Capacity Q = 3.6 X Load cross sectional area perpendicular to belt (m^2) X Belt speed (m/s) X Material density (kg/m^3) = 3.6 x A x V x ρ Tonnes/hr. 5.Mass of material per unit length M (kg/m)

12.10.2017Correcting this is typically done by one of two methods: by removing mass from the "heavy" point (which is commonly achieved by drilling a small hole in the pulley) or by adding mass to a point 180 degrees from the "heavy" point. Static balancing is typically sufficient for pulleys that travel at 6500 ft/min (33 m/s) or less.

29.07.2015Here's a simple equation you can use to calculate steps per mm for linear motion with belts and pulleys. Nt is the number of teeth on the pulley attached to the motor shaft. EXAMPLE: Using the motor in our previous example with 2x microstepping, 2 mm pitch belts and a 20 teeth pulley will give us 10 steps per mm, i.e. a resolution of 0.1mm.

A belt conveyor system consists of two or more pulleys (sometimes referred to as drums), with an endless loop of carrying medium—the conveyor belt—that rotates about them. One or both of the pulleys are powered, moving the belt and the material on the belt forward. The powered pulley is called the drive pulley while the unpowered pulley is called the idler pulley.
